In the requirements for business visa it says that the invitation letter should be from
"Invitation Letter of Duly Authorized Unit" could you please tell me what exactly that means? I am working with a factory in china and they will send me an invitation would that be enough or should they get an authorization from an government agency?

the official invitation letter should be authorized from local BUREAU OF FOREIGN TRADE AND ECONOMIC COOPERATION.
